ASSESSMENT OF VIBRATION SUSCEPTIBILITY OF ELECTRONIC EQUIPMENT IN FORMULA ONE CARS

L. Cocco, P.Gazzola, S.Rapuano, L. Rossi
Abstract:
The total noise level in racing car environment is very high, in fact the engine can reach 20000 rpm (revolutions per minute) and the vehicle structure is very stiff. Upper-grade levels in terms of shock, vibration and temperatures need a careful understanding of damage mechanism, which will be active in this environment. This paper presents an experimental vibration diagnostic methodology implemented on Ferrari racing car model 248F1.
